Segmented Pressure and Heating Control for Hard-to-Hard Lamination Debubbling
Hard-to-hard lamination — glass-to-glass CG bonding, ITO+CG, FILM+CG, and CTP+LCD module assembly — behaves differently from film-to-glass bonding. The adhesive layer sits between two rigid substrates with no compliant surface to absorb pressure variation. Residual air trapped in that interface does not migrate out on its own, and a single fixed pressure-and-temperature cycle is often not enough to clear it consistently across a full panel.

The 800×1200 stainless steel bubble remover machine is built for this class of work. Its φ800mm diameter × 1200mm depth stainless steel chamber accepts large-format panels on multi-tier perforated trays. Its control system is a segmented high-pressure defoaming controller — you can set ten separate time intervals for heating and pressure application within a single cycle, and the machine collects bubble-removal data across those intervals.

This is process control at a level that fixed-cycle machines do not provide.

Chamber: φ800mm Diameter × 1200mm Depth — Multi-Tier Loading for Large Panels

The chamber interior uses perforated stainless steel trays on multiple shelf levels, visible in the open-door product images. The perforation pattern allows pressurised air to reach all surfaces of the loaded panels rather than being blocked by solid tray plates — this is what makes even pressure distribution possible across a stacked load.

The 800mm diameter sets the usable loading width for panels and fixtures. The 1200mm depth allows deep multi-tray batch loading along the chamber axis. Actual panel quantity per cycle depends on panel size, thickness, and tray spacing.

Segmented Process Control — Ten Programmable Time Intervals

This is the defining capability of this machine, confirmed directly from product documentation:

Three process sequence options:

  • Heating first, then pressure

  • Pressure first, then heating

  • Simultaneous heating and pressure

Ten programmable time intervals. The machine is a segmented high-pressure defoaming system. Within a single cycle, you can define up to ten separate time intervals, each with its own heating and pressure application settings. This allows you to build a staged process curve rather than applying one flat condition for the entire cycle.

Bubble removal data collection. The system collects bubble-removal data across the programmed intervals.

Why segmented control matters for hard-to-hard lamination: Different adhesive systems and different substrate combinations respond to different pressure-temperature sequences. A CTP+LCD module may require gradual pressure ramping to avoid stressing the touch layer, while a CG-to-CG bond may benefit from heating before pressurisation to reduce adhesive viscosity first. A machine that only offers one fixed cycle forces every product through the same conditions. Segmented control lets you match the process to the product.

Touch Screen Operation Panel with PLC Control

The machine uses a programmable logic controller (PLC) to control operation of the whole machine, with a touchscreen man-machine interface.

System interfaces:

  • Auto Interface — automated cycle execution

  • Parameter Interface — process parameter setting and storage

  • I/O Interface — input/output diagnostics

The interface displays date and running time on screen. The manual interface allows individual component actuation for setup, testing, and maintenance verification — useful when validating a new product or diagnosing a process issue.

Q4. What problems will this machine not solve?
A bubble remover eliminates residual air from a properly executed lamination. It will not remove particles sealed under adhesive, correct panel or layer misalignment in a CTP+LCD assembly, recover panels bonded with out-of-spec adhesive, or compensate for fixture failure during lamination.Ten programmable intervals give you far more process flexibility than a fixed-cycle machine — but no interval configuration will fix a defect whose root cause is upstream.
